Air fryer cooking offers several benefits. It allows for faster cooking times due to rapid air circulation, which evenly distributes heat, resulting in consistent cooking. Using an air fryer reduces the need for oil, making dishes healthier. With minimal preheating time compared to traditional ovens, the air fryer provides convenience for quick meal preparations. Cleanup is easier since most air fryer parts are dishwasher safe, eliminating the mess usually associated with frying.

Why Choose Oysters on the Half Shell?

Oysters on the half shell present a classic delicacy. They provide a premium seafood experience, often reserved for special occasions. When prepared in an air fryer, oysters retain their briny essence while achieving a crispy texture. This combination enhances the oysters’ natural flavors without the heavy breading typical of deep-fried versions. Serving oysters on the half shell showcases their visual appeal, making them an impressive addition to any meal.

Key Ingredients for Air Fryer Oysters

Selecting the Best Oysters

Freshness impacts taste and texture in oysters. Visit a reputable seafood market to find the freshest oysters. Look for oysters with tightly closed shells. Open shells might indicate dead oysters, which you should avoid. Choose oysters that feel heavy for their size, as this means they contain more briny liquid, enhancing flavor.

Essential Seasonings and Preparations

Proper seasoning and preparation elevate the dish. Start with a base seasoning mix of salt, black pepper, and garlic powder. To add complexity, incorporate paprika, lemon zest, and finely chopped parsley. An optional sprinkle of Parmesan cheese boosts flavor further.

Prepare the oysters by scrubbing the shells under cold water to remove any grit. Use an oyster knife to shuck the oysters, preserving the briny liquid. Once the oysters are on the half shell, apply the seasoning evenly across each oyster to ensure a balanced taste.

Step-by-Step Cooking Process

Preparing the Oysters

Start by ensuring the oysters are thoroughly cleaned. Scrub the shells under cold water to remove any debris. Once cleaned, carefully shuck the oysters, taking care to preserve the brine within the shell. Place each oyster on a tray and pat them dry with a paper towel. Evenly apply your base seasoning mix to enhance the natural flavors. For added zest, sprinkle optional ingredients like paprika, lemon zest, parsley, and Parmesan cheese.

Cooking Times and Temperatures

Preheat your air fryer to 400°F. Place the seasoned oysters in the air fryer basket, ensuring they do not overlap. Cook the oysters for 8-10 minutes. Check for a golden, crispy topping, which indicates they’re ready. If needed, cook for an additional 1-2 minutes, but avoid overcooking to maintain the oysters’ tender texture. Serve immediately for the best experience.

Serving Suggestions

Pairing Sauces and Sides

Complement air fryer oysters with a variety of sauces and sides for a complete dining experience. Classic options include cocktail sauce, mignonette sauce, and aioli. These sauces enhance the oysters’ flavors with their tangy, savory profiles. Try a garlic butter sauce for a richer taste.

For sides, consider serving the oysters with crusty bread, lemon wedges, and fresh greens. Crusty bread adds texture and complements the oysters’ brininess. Lemon wedges provide a citrusy contrast. A simple salad with vinaigrette pairs well, adding a fresh element to your plate.

Presentation Tips

Present air fryer oysters on a platter for a visually appealing display. Arrange them on a bed of crushed ice to keep them fresh and highlight their natural beauty. Garnish with lemon wedges and fresh herbs like parsley or dill for a pop of color.

Use oyster forks or small spoons for easy eating. Including small dipping bowls for the sauces ensures guests can customize each bite. Place the platter in the center of the table to create a shared experience, inviting guests to savor the enhanced flavor and crispy texture of the air-fried oysters.
